-------------------------------------------------------In last month's, May, 
Windows IT Pro Magazine I wrote an article that
reviewed six different archiving applications.  Quest Archive Manager
has added off-line and PST support since I reviewed their product.  They
also had the best looking UI.  Symantec's Enterprise Vault got the
Editors Choice Reward.

Other product reviewed were Mimosa System's NearPoint, which is also a
good backup\DR product for Exchange; GFI MailArchiver, very basic
product; C2C's Archive One, good product with lots of flexibility; and
Sherpa Software's Mail & Archive Attender (two products), you need both
to meet most archiving needs.

You can read it on-line at:
http://www.windowsitpro.com/Article/ArticleID/49712/49712.html.

Unfortunately, ZANTAZ and EMC didn't respond to my request for an eval
version of their product within the timeframe needed, a month. I have
heard good things about ZANTAZ's solution, haven't ran across anyone
using the EMC one but that doesn't mean it isn't good also.

-------------------------------------------------------Hello All-

I would like to archive users email, but still make it look as though
the message is still on the Exchange server (PST files stored on local
machine = BAD!!!).  I know there are SQL server based products out
there, does anyone have any suggestions?
